Is Now a Good Time to Buy a Car?

Vehicles on the lot at Sunset


You’ve probably heard talk that now is by far the worst time to buy a car, but that’s really not true. Some would say it’s a faulty generalization. Why is that? While there are undoubtedly inventory shortages, that doesn’t mean that it’s a bad time to buy a car — especially if you need one and if leasing isn’t the right long-term choice. What’s more, it doesn’t take into account that now is a fantastic time to purchase a vehicle. If you’re looking to buy a car and trade in your old car, the extra boost in value could very well more than offset the higher prices that new and used vehicles are currently fetching. Is Now a Good Time to Buy a New Car?

New cars are, undoubtedly, more expensive now than they’ve been in a while. Due to changes in international trade policies, many manufacturers are seeing higher vehicle prices across the board. You may not necessarily get the best overall purchase price or discount.

Is Now a Good Time to Buy a Used Car?

While used cars may be more expensive on average now than in the past, there’s good news for used car shoppers. Used cars that are being swiped up faster than ever, meaning that many of the ones that show up are coming off prior leases. This also means that these vehicles are, by and large, more reliable than the average used car that you may find in stock during more “normal” times. Is Now a Good Time to Trade In a Car?

Yes! Now is the ideal time to buy a car and trade in your old one. Let’s do some hypothetical math:

Say you use our payment calculator to see if buying a $44,000 car is a good idea. Let’s say, for argument’s sake, that this vehicle would normally sell for $42,000. If you’re trading in a vehicle that would normally fetch $20,000, but now you can get $23,000 for it, you’re already ahead of the game!
